Body

Origins and Family

Saul Greenberg was born on 1954[2].

Education

Saul Greenberg's education included a stint at University of Calgary[12]. His doctoral advisor was Ian H. Witten[13].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include computer scientist[3], scientist[4], university teacher[5], and researcher[6]. Fields of work include human–computer interaction[8], an academic discipline[27]; user interface[9]; and design[10], a field of study[28]. Saul Greenberg was employed by University of Calgary[11]. Doctoral students include Carl Andrew Gutwin[18], Edward Hiatt Tse[19], Carman Gerard Neustaedter[20], Michael John Boyle[21], and Charlotte Tang[22].

Recognition

Saul Greenberg received the ACM Fellow[14].
